AJ05 RHA is a 2005 Ford Mondeo in Silver with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.3%.

Across all 2005 Ford Mondeo models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.1% with a typical mileage of 89,401 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Mondeo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 610,562 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AJ05 RHA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Mondeo typ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 21 years old, this Ford Mondeo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
